Web1 Oct 2002 · In the United States, animal feed is frequently contaminated with non-Typhi serotypes of Salmonella enterica and may lead to infection or colonization of food animals. These bacteria can contaminate animal carcasses at slaughter or cross-contaminate other food items, leading to human illness. Web16 Sep 2002 · Tainted feed 'source of unexpected BSE'.
